Busscar Delivers New El Buss 320 to Transtusa for Charter and Regional Operations
Busscar has delivered a new El Buss 320 bus to Transtusa, configured for comfort, accessibility, and efficiency in short- and medium-distance passenger transport.
47
What Happened
The new El Buss 320, built on a Volkswagen VW 17.230 chassis, seats 47 passengers with Class Superpullman seats. It features air conditioning with pollen filter, a wheelchair lift, two reserved seats with tactile identification, electronic route sign with Wi-Fi, LED lighting, and two sunroofs. Safety items include parking sensor with display, reverse camera, and preparation for electronic ticket validation.
